Mastering the C# Switch Statement

The case construct in C# provides a powerful and efficient way to implement different blocks of code based on the value of an operand. It offers a readable and clear alternative to using a series of if-else statements, especially when dealing with multiple possible outcomes. Leveraging C# Switch Case for Streamlined Code

In the realm of software development, efficiency is paramount. Developers constantly seek techniques to shorten code complexity while maintaining readability and robustness. C#, a versatile object-oriented language, provides a powerful tool called the "switch case" statement that facilitates streamlined coding practices. This construct allows for concisely handling multiple cases, more info thereby reducing duplication in your codebase.

Beyond this, C# allows for the use of "default" cases within switch statements, providing a graceful way to handle unexpected conditions. This provides your code is more resilient in the face of unexpected input.
